Binge, Stream or Skip? Drama Review // Cute Programmer《程序员那么可爱》

 

You can watch the trailer above or start watching episode one here.

Warning! Spoilers ahead.

I mostly watched the last few episodes on 2x speed as it was getting somewhat draggy and annoying. BUT, the front parts, at least the first half of the drama, were still highly entertaining and quite light-hearted so I would still say that this drama is stream-able but borderline skippable.


Synopsis: (taken from the official Youtube channel, Tencent Video)

After falling in love with genius programmer Jiang Yicheng, Lu Li enrolls into the school he once studied at, and also took up the same major - calculus. Setting Jiang Yicheng as her role model in her heart, she achieves good grades in school. However after graduation, she did not expect that Jiang Yicheng's company does not recruit female employees. Lu Li decides to disguise as a man and enter the company. However, she met difficulty both in dealing with Jiang Yicheng's demands, as well as hiding her identity. Finally with her perseverance, she grabbed hold of an opportunity and managed to come to an agreement with Jiang Yicheng. The two would become a "contract couple" and stay together for one year. Slowly, Jiang Yicheng finds himself falling for Lu Li.

Note: Instead of calculus, I think they meant computer science.


What I like about this drama:

Contractual marriage. Anything that has contractual marriage, a good-looking CEO as the male lead, I like. This drama is one of those typical contractual marriage dramas where the male lead (ML) is those arrogant CEO while the female lead (FL) is the one head over heels for the other party first and so, is very sacrificial in their relationship initially. Nothing very special in particular, nonetheless still entertaining as I like romance cliches.

Although somewhat a classic contractual marriage centered storyline, this drama is different such that you don't get a mean mother-in-law for the FL. Instead, the ML's mother is the one who very much pushed for the couple to get together, albeit, quite forcefully, on the guy's end. The FL, of course, is very much willing to do it. The parents of both the ML and FL are very supportive of their children, so no mean parents in this drama.


Who I like in this drama:

Chen Yiming and Jiang Zitong. Basically, one of the more prominent side couples. Chen Yiming being the ML's best friend and later on, also a good friend of the FL. Jiang Zitong being the ML's younger sister. Both of them are the biggest supporters of the main couple. Like at least, using a much less forceful method, unlike the ML's mother, who every now and then threatens the ML via his father. Initially I thought Chen Yiming would be that nice second lead but I'm actually very glad that he wasn't.

Then there is Gu Xiaoqi, the super loyal best friend of the FL. I swear, the FL's BFF in such romance shows are always the best. They are super loyal, super supportive even though they get neglected after the FL gets the guy.


What I don't like about this drama:

It got very irritating towards the back, like when the FL left the ML. The pile of misunderstandings stacking, which is typical and expected of such storylines by now, hence these parts can be watched on 2x speed.


Who I don't like (or possibly even dislike) in this drama:

Li Man, the main antagonist of this drama, and the ex-girlfriend of the ML. All her petty tricks and stuff that main antagonists do to break up the couple. But, they are married! How could she still! Whether their relationship has love for each other or not, it shouldn't matter to her. They are legally married, so she should have backed off. Funny thing is, this actress played a similar character in another drama, Perfect and Casual. Not hating on the actress but, just hoping that she don't get stuck in such roles!


Other notes:

At some point, I lost interest in the main couple and were more interested in the side couples. Aside from the side couples, what was entertaining was how ALL their parents are such matchmakers. Yes, including Gu Xiaoqi and Gu Mo's parents.
